You are here
Every CEX Needs a DEX
$ 82,748.6
€ 76,460.3
¥ 38,800.0
£ 63,961.1
$ 1,812.67
€ 1,674.81
¥ 849.99
£ 1,402.47
$ 216.68
€ 200.22
¥ 101.66
£ 167.46
Submitted by Anonymous (not verified) on Thu, 06/15/2023 - 23:50